
Hunter may be best WR talent but will play more defense; limits offensive upside.
Travis HunterWR
The source notes that Travis Hunter might still be the best wide receiver on the Jaguars roster currently, but he is going to play more on the defensive side of the ball, limiting his offensive upside. He was operating out of the slot role to start last year before getting injured, after which Parker Washington was thrown into that role. His dual-sport role means he won't be a full-time offensive player, similar to how Trey Harris is ranked behind him despite not being a full-time offensive player.
